TSREIS hyderabad- Opening of Thirty (30) Residential Degree Colleges for Girls exclusively for the marginalized sections to be run under the TSWREI Society from the Academic Year 2016-17 in Telangana State 116 institutions are upgraded having Intermediate sections in various groups. In intermediate the main courses offered are M.P.C., Bi.P.C, C.E.C., H.E.C. and a few other vocational courses in certain limited number of institutions. There are two sections comprising 40 students each in 1st year and 2nd year. Every year more than 9000 students pass out of the TSWREI Society junior colleges
There are no degree colleges providing free education to economically poor children. The marginalized communities are compelled to force stop their wards further education as they cant afford the exorbitant expenses to be incurred in private degree colleges. This has serious repercussions on the lives of the downtrodden people especially the girl children who are becoming victims of early marriages, thus annulling the good work done by the TSWREI Society which took care of them till their Intermediate Education.
Thirty (30) degree colleges for Girls exclusively in fully residential pattern to be started with free accommodation, boarding and other amenities. TSWREI Society is proposing to start the colleges with 7 courses with each section comprising 40 students

After careful consideration of the above proposal of Secretary, TSWREI Society Hyderabad.Government hereby accord administrative sanction for Opening of New One Hundred and Three (103) Residential Schools for Boys and Girls and Thirty (30) Degree colleges for Girls exclusively for the marginalized sections to be run under the TSWREI Society from the Academic
Year 2016-17 in Telangana State as per Annexure-I & II enclosed
